City dad holds preliminary hearing vs 5 kagawads
-A A +ASaturday, September 15, 2012
THE City Council Committee of Laws, Ordinances and Good Government chaired by Councilor Caesar Distrito held a preliminary hearing against five barangay kagawads, who face raps for abuse of authority, oppression, dereliction of duty and misconduct in office.
The case was filed by Cristita Redil, a resident of the same barangay and staff of Councilor Mona Dia Jardin.
The five kagawads are Felipe Hilado, Sanny Barcenal, Milagros Casilangan, Joel Lavarro and Rodrigo Tamayo.
The complaint is about the alleged insults and criticisms that were thrown by the five kagawads against Redil during a meeting of the purok presidents and leaders in Barangay Felisa.
Redil mentioned in her complaint-affidavit that on June 14, 2012 that she was called for a meeting by the kagawads and was told to explain about the signature gathering that she and the purok leaders were doing for the recall of the same kagawads. She was then confronted and bombarded with insults, criticisms, and defamations and was severely embarrassed in front of many people.
She added that she immediately reported the incident to Police Station 10 and filed a complaint against them in the City Council. (Carla N. Canet)
